Comparative income statements for Pearle Company are provided below:
Pearle CompanyComparative Income Statement Years Ended December 31, Year 2 Year 1 Sales $595,000$532,200 Less cost of goods sold 386,200357,650 Gross margin 208,800174,550 Less operating expenses 108,95099,770 Income before taxes 99,85074,780 Income taxes 39,94029,912 Net income $59,910$44,868\begin{array}{c}\text {Pearle Company}\\ \text {Comparative Income Statement}\\\text { Years Ended December 31,}\\\\\begin{array}{lrr}&\text { Year } 2 &\text { Year } 1\\\text { Sales } & \$ 595,000 & \$ 532,200 \\\text { Less cost of goods sold } & 386,200 & 357,650 \\\text { Gross margin } & 208,800 & 174,550 \\\text { Less operating expenses } & 108,950 & 99,770 \\\text { Income before taxes } & 99,850 & 74,780 \\\text { Income taxes } & 39,940 & 29,912 \\\text { Net income } & \$ 59,910 & \$ 44,868\end{array}\end{array}
Required:
Perform a horizontal analysis of Pearle Company's income statement by computing horizontal percentages for each item.Round your answer to one decimal place (i.e.,22.5%).


Definitions:

Pairwise Majority Voting

A voting system in which each option is compared head-to-head with every other option, and the option that wins the most comparisons is selected.

Transitivity

The concept in mathematics and logic that if relation "A" is related to "B", and "B" is related to "C", then "A" is related to "C".

Prefers

Indicates a choice or inclination for one option over others based on certain criteria or personal judgment.

Transitivity

In decision theory and economics, the concept that if option A is preferred to B, and B is preferred to C, then A should be preferred to C.
